Cenchrus echinatus Southern sandbur (Cenchrus echinatus) is a native Florida annual grass with a shallow root system perfectly adapted to dry, sandy soil. The ligule is replaced by a ring of hairs (0.7-1.7 mm long); auricles are absent. Sudan (Kordofan, Darfur): seeds removed from husks by rubbing spikes between two pieces of leather. Mossman River grass (Cenchrus echinatus) is mainly regarded as an environmental weed in northern Queensland, the Northern Territory, and the northern parts of Western Australia. Hawaii, Sandbur Toxic Principle The spiny burs are not toxic but cause tramuatic injury to animals. Distribution: Cenchrus echinatus occurs on all island groupings within the Lucayan Archipelago as well as the entire Caribbean region, North, Central, and South America. In feeds and hay, the burs of the seed heads reduce the acceptability and palatability of the feed to animals. The invasion of noxious weeds in agricultural lands causes serious problems that have negative impact on ecosystems, native gene pools and commercial crop productivity [].Cenchrus echinatus L. is known by the common name southern sandbur or spiny sandbur, is a notorious invasive and noxious weed which belongs to the family Poaceae.
